IMG_0108.jpgIMG_0107.jpgIMG_0077.jpgI have read the tortoise library food suggestions and have done some of my own research as well. The question being, how much fruit is too much fruit for yellowfoots? I know they are thought to eat more than reds (I believe) but what’s too much? A little bit mixed in with each feeding? Once a week? Once a month? The same goes for proteins. I have heard of people using low fat dog or cat food, is this any good? Or should you stick to earthworks and boiled chicken and eggs? Greens and vegetables, I have that down pat. Just wondering about the other stuff. Here are a few pictures of my Wolley. Thanks everyone and have a wonderful weekend.

Your going to get several opinions on this I don't think there's a set standard. I feed my Redfoots greens and some kind of fruit everyday. Protein once a week. Just switch it up and feed a lot of variety. Not the same thing two days in a row.

I feed my YF tortoises greens daily, fruit and animal protein two or three times a week. some of the animal protein I use: Wellness brand venison/sweet potato canned dog food, Purina Pro Plan moistened dry cat food, hard boiled eggs, cooked chicken, snails, fish, etc.
